In the fifth verse (61), mention has been made of the all-encompassing knowledge of the most exalted Allah and its unmatched multi-dimensional extensions. The address is to the Holy Prophet ﷺ . He is being told that nothing he does by way of his work or recital of the Qur'an remains hidden from Allah. Similarly, whatever all human beings do remains before Him. And not even a single particle in the heavens and the earth is concealed from Him. Rather, everything is written in the clear Book, that is, the Preserved Tablet (al lawh al-mahfuz).
At this place, as it seems, the wisdom of describing the all-encompassing nature of Divine knowledge is aimed at consoling the Holy Prophet ﷺ that his enemies cannot harm him in any way for he was under the protection of Allah Ta` ala.
Allah informed His Prophet that He knows and is well acquainted with all of the affairs and conditions of him and his Ummah and all of creation and its creatures at all times -- during every hour and second. Nothing slips or escapes from His knowledge and observation, not even anything the weight of a speck of dust within the heavens or earth, or anything that is smaller or larger than that. Everything is in a manifest Book, as Allah said:
(And with Him are the keys of the Ghayb (all that is hidden and unseen), none knows them but He. And He knows whatever there is in the land and in the sea; not a leaf falls, but He knows it. There is not a grain in the darkness of the earth nor anything fresh or dry, but is written in a Clear Record.)(6:59) He stated that He is Well-Aware of the movement of the trees and other inanimate objects. He is also Well-Aware of all grazing beasts. He said:
(There is not a moving creature on earth, nor a bird that flies with its two wings, but are communities like you.) (6:38) He also said:
(And no moving creature is there on earth but its provision is due from Allah. )(11:6) If this is His knowledge of the movement of these things, then what about His knowledge of the movement of the creatures that are commanded to worship Him Allah said:
(And put your trust in the Almighty, the Most Merciful, Who sees you when you stand up, and your movements among those who fall prostrate.)(26:217-219) That is why Allah said:
(Neither you do any deed nor recite any portion of the Qur'an, nor you do any deed, but We are Witness thereof when you are doing it.) meaning, `We are watching and hearing you when you engage in that thing.' When Jibril asked the Prophet about Ihsan, he said:
(It is that you worship Allah as if you are seeing Him. But since you do not see Him, be certain that He is watching you.)
